
Unsung heroes: Sue of the Family Enclosure
Sue of the Family Enclosure - a heartbeat of Everton, and Goodison Park. Story by Laura Gates with input from fans.

Some people make football more than just a game—Sue is one of them. She’s been a friendly face at Goodison for as long as I can remember, looking out for me since I was a kid. Match days wouldn’t be the same without her warmth and kindness. Although I no longer sit in her area of the ground, we catch up on social media and she checks in with my mum who sits in her block.
Whenever I get to see Sue at the match these days, it’s always a nice surprise.
Prior to kick off against Bournemouth in the FA Cup, I heard someone shouting my name down Goodison Road. When I turned around it was Sue, ready for a big hug.
“I’m off to go get my photo with the FA Cup, I can’t wait!”
I’ve always wanted to capture Sue at Goodison, as one of my main features of match days growing up.

When I asked Sue if I could share these photos, she said "of course, your family means so much to me too."
Since posting this story on social media, Sue has attracted so many comments full of love and stories.
